I immediately have so many headcanons for how things could change, but here’s Yakko meeting Pinky and Brain!
*
“What are you doing in here?” a deep voice demanded.
Guards! was Yakko’s first panicked thought. He immediately ran for it, instinctively running to the dais, towards the family portrait. He skidded to a halt under the portrait and spun around, mallet at the ready, fangs on show.
And he froze.
It wasn’t guards.
It was a pair of small white mice; very odd looking mice. Familiar looking mice.
“How did you get in- oh…” The smaller mouse trailed off, eyes wide. “Oh my…”
“Narf! Who’re you?” the taller mouse asked.
Yakko let his mallet vanish, staring at the smaller mouse. He knew this mouse. He remembered this very same mouse ushering them into the tunnel, helping them escape. He remembered this mouse shoving the hidden door closed mere seconds before Salazar’s soldiers burst into the room.
Unbidden, tears stung his eyes, though he was smiling, grinning so hard it hurt his cheeks. Laughing, he ran over to them and crashed to his knees.
“It’s you!” he cried.
“I- pardon?” the smaller mouse asked.
“You got us out!” Yakko said. The mice both gaped at him, but Yakko was already rambling away; “You got us out that night, I thought they would have killed you for sure!” He thought of his siblings and had to wipe at his eyes. He clutched his pendant. “You saved Wakko and Dot, thank you.”
“Oh,” the taller mouse whispered. “Oh, Brain...”
The smaller mouse- Brain?- was gaping at Yakko, eyes wide. Yakko braced himself for a denial, for the mouse to say he had no idea what Yakko was talking about. Indeed, he expected the mouse to not believe that Yakko was...Well, Yakko.
Instead, the mouse bowed. For the first time in five years, Yakko was addressed by his title.
“Your Highness.”
